Responsibilities

  • Provide basic nursing care that aligns with the vision, mission, philosophy, goals, and objectives of the nursing services and the hospital.
  • Notify the nursing leaders of any situations that impact the quality of care.
  • Obtain ward report and assignment at the beginning of each shift and perform additional tasks as assigned by the Unit Manager or Senior Registered Nurse.
  • Conduct regular nursing rounds to assess patients’ needs and communicate with them and their families.
  • Prepare and tidy patients’ beds and linens as needed and organize patients’ belongings as well as furniture.
  • Disinfect beds, furniture, and equipment after utilizing them.
  • Keep the ward, store, fridge, and its facilities clean and tidy.
  • Assist the patient with Activities of Daily Living
  • Answer phone calls and relay messages.
  • Attend to patients’ call bells promptly.
  • Assist nurses in transporting patients to and from the operating theatre.
  • Escort patients to other services for diagnostic tests and from the ward to other areas upon discharge.
  • Dispatch specimens to the laboratory and collect results
  • Collect pharmacy and surgical supplies to maintain adequate stock levels for operations.
  • Send out portable oxygen tanks for refilling or exchange, ensuring a continuous supply for emergency needs.
  • Assist the trained staff in various aspects: patient comfort, safety, nutrition, hygiene, admission, transfer, discharge, dressing, intravenous lines, catheterization, etc.
  • Cleans and disinfects the trolley and instruments after use and stores them properly.
  • Record daily charges for items used in the ward and update patients’ charges accordingly.
  • Maintain the record of intake and output chart for each patient.
  • Lift, turn, and position patients safely
  • Accompany the consultant in performing procedures and rounds in the absence of trained nurses
  • Attend meetings held by the service.

KPJ Healthcare Berhad is the leading provider of private healthcare services in Malaysia, with a history dating back to 1981 when it introduced the first private specialist hospital in Johor. The Group's core values of Safety, Courtesy, Integrity, Professionalism, and Continuous Improvement drive its integrated network of more than 29 specialist hospitals across Malaysia. Additionally, KPJ has expanded its presence internationally, with hospitals in Indonesia, Bangkok, and Bangladesh, as well as investments in retirement and age-care resorts in Australia and Malaysia.

KPJ's competitive advantage stems from its extensive reach and accessibility throughout the nation, offering a wide range of medical specialist services, some of which are pioneering in the country's healthcare industry. The company also excels in utilizing integrated technology to enhance patient care, including the adoption of Cloud Computing and continuous improvements to the KPJ Clinical Information System (KCIS). Furthermore, KPJ is exploring digitalized medical technology applications in areas such as E-Pharmacy, wearable technology, robotics, Artificial Intelligence (AI), and the Internet of Things (IoT).

With over three and a half decades of experience in hospital development and management, KPJ is built on strong fundamentals, positioning it well for the evolving healthcare industry. The company's health tourism segment has experienced significant growth through aggressive marketing strategies, expanding its footprint in various regions.

In addition to hospital-based care, KPJ has made strides in healthcare-related industries, particularly in KPJ Senior Living Care services and Healthcare Education, recognizing their potential for the future due to increasing consumer demand. KPJ hospitals have received recognition from accreditation bodies, ensuring the quality and safety of their services.

The company is committed to giving back to the community and has established a network of Klinik Wakaf An-Nur (KWAN) charity clinics and a Hospital Waqaf An-Nur (HWAN) to provide care to the underprivileged. With 18 KWAN clinics and five mobile clinics, KPJ's efforts have positively impacted over one million patients since 1998.

Overall, KPJ Healthcare Berhad's extensive network, commitment to innovation, and dedication to quality healthcare services and community outreach make it a prominent and trusted player in the private healthcare industry.
